Dominos started back in 1960 as a single-store location in Ypsilanti, Michigan. Over the years, we expanded to three stores, and thus came the three dots on our logo. The original plan was to keep adding dots for every store, and at over 18,000 stores worldwide (6,300 in the U.S.) you can probably figure out why that original plan didnt work.
**Job Details**
RESPONSIBILITIES AND DUTIES
(70%) Moving and Operation of Tractor/Trailer
Walk the yard to identify and document vehicle defects. Communicate maintenance needs to D&S TLs
Obtain tractor/trailer list from D&S, record odometer, hub readings and engine hours from equipment and fax to lease company
Ensure that trailers loaded with refrigerated product, i.e., cheese or chicken, are at adequate temperature
Ensure Warehouse Team Members have trailers to unload and/or load
Reposition tractor/trailers on the yard to and from docks
Comply with Dominos Pizza Chock, Safety Cone and Dock Signal Light policy
Shuttle tractor/trailers to and from logistic supplier
Take trailers to be washed and cleaned
Assist with backhauls
May be assigned to assist Drivers on a designated route(s) to unload product to Domino's Pizza stores
Listen to and timely assist Drivers
Required to wear and follow Dominos Pizza uniform standards at all times
Attend scheduled safety, team meetings and training sessions
(30%) Complete Necessary Paperwork
Maintain DVCR booklets
Comply with DOT log regulations
Accountable for the vehicle and product
Daily complete timesheets and forward to D&S Department
**Qualifications**
QUALIFICATIONS
High School Diploma or GED
Must be at least 18 years of age
Satisfactory completion of a Professional Truck Driving Institute training program
One hour of classroom instruction facilitated by the Delivery and Service Team Leader which covers Dominos Pizza Chock, Safety Cone and Dock Signal Light Policy, Accident Procedure Policy and any other pertinent policy and/or instruction information.
Must meet the defined MVR standards at all times to remain qualified to drive company commercial motor vehicle
Must be able to lift up to 50 lbs., frequently perform heavy pushing/pulling of product and work in refrigerated conditions <33-38 degrees>
